Obtain the right dimensions


It is really important that your dishwashing machine suits perfectly with the rest of your kitchen area devices. Before you put an order for the dishwashing machine, take a measuring tape and procedure front the top of the cooking area table to about an inch off the floor. This is a typical blunder many individuals make. If you measure from the top of the table to the floor, your dishwashing machine might be an inch higher than the table when it arrives.
Likewise, take the outcropping right into account. European and American dishwashing machines have different densities, so constantly consult your plumber.

Inspect your water shut-off shutoff


Your dishwashing machine will certainly have its own connection. It may be linked to your kitchen sink's supply, or it may have its own fixtures from your main. Nonetheless, you require to recognize that you can regulate the water that provides your brand-new dishwashing machine.
While getting ready for the installment, switch off all links to the kitchen. This can prevent accidents and interruptions.
Checking your shut-off valve before your plumber arrives can also prevent you from unexpected spendings because you can't connect a new dishwasher to a faulty shut off valve.
Also make sure that there are no cross links that can stop your dish washer from fuming water.

Locate the electrical resource
Before inviting your plumbings over, ensure that there is a power outlet close to your recommended dish washer area. If there isn't, you might need to run a wire to that area. These little mistakes can make or mar your experience, so you would certainly do well to check beforehand.
You can utilize this possibility to inspect that your kitchen has an independent control so that you can shut off the cooking area's power simultaneously while taking pleasure in power in the rest of your home. This straightforward component can avoid multiple accidents and also conserve you some money.

    How to plan for installing a dishwasher in your kitchen


    Figure out the location of the machine


    The main thing you will need to be sure about when it comes to the location of your dishwasher is that the machine will be able to be connected to both water and waste pipes. If these aren’t present in your designated choice of location, then you will have to decide on somewhere else to put it or call in a plumber. Most dishwashers only require a cold water supply though.



    The best place to put a dishwasher is against an exterior wall, as this way you won’t require a waste pipe running the length of your house. You will also want it placed onto a firm, flat floor to cope with any vibrations or movements.



    Most people also make sure that their dishwasher is located next to the sink, so that plates and dishes can be easily transferred to the machine. If you don’t have space in your kitchen for a dishwasher – why not try re-locating your washing machine to a garage or cellar?



    Standard dishwashers require at least a 24-inch (60cm) wide opening to make sure that there is enough space for the machine to fit easy. Those who are installing a dishwasher in their kitchen for the very first time will also need to make sure that they have drilled holes for water inlets, a drainage tube and for the electrical wires which come with the device.


    Linking up to a power supply


    If you don’t have any electrical sockets nearby for your dishwasher, then you will have to call in a qualified electrician to do this.



    Most of the time, dishwashers will run off their own circuit, however you can alternatively tie it in to your current kitchen circuit. You will have to check this with your local building codes however, as this is prohibited in some situations.


    Preparing the dishwasher cabinet


    As well as these main issues, you will also have to think about the cabinet that is going to hold your dishwasher. The first thing you will need to do is paint the inside with moisture-proof paint, as this will prevent any build-up of build-up of mildew that could result from the steam.



    You will then need to decide if you want a door for the cabinet to match with the other units in your kitchen and keep it tucked away. You could also try a piece of fabric covering the appliance, which some may prefer stylistically. This last option could also be cheaper.
